Certificate II in Community Services
Course Overview
Start your career in community services with this entry-level qualification. This course will give you the foundation skills required to enter the community services industry or complete further studies in this field.
What You'll Study
The successful achievement of this qualification requires you to complete all core and 4 elective units from the list below.
Core Units
- BSBWOR202: Organise and complete daily work activities
- CHCCOM001: Provide first point of contact
- CHCCOM005: Communicate and work in health or community services
- CHCDIV001: Work with diverse people
- HLTWHS001: Participate in workplace health and safety
Elective Units
- Early Childhood Focus:
- CHCECE002: Ensure the health and safety of children
- CHCECE004: Promote and provide healthy food and drinks
- HLTFSE001: Follow basic food safety practices
- CHCECE056: Work effectively in children's education and care
- Community Work Focus (Greater Brisbane):
- BSBTWK201: Work effectively with others
- CHCCDE003: Work within a community development framework
- CHCCOM002: Use communication to build relationships
- CHCDIV002: Promote Aboriginal and/or Torres Strait Islander cultural safety
- Community Work Focus (Gold Coast):
- CHCADV001: Facilitate the interests and rights of clients
- CHCCCS016: Respond to client needs
- CHCDIV002: Promote Aboriginal and/or Torres Strait Islander cultural safety
- HLTAID010: Provide basic emergency life support
- Community Work Focus (Sunshine Coast):
- BSBWOR301: Organise personal work priorities and development
- CHCCDE003: Work within a community development framework
- CHCDIV002: Promote Aboriginal and/or Torres Strait Islander cultural safety
- HLTWHS006: Manage personal stressors in the work environment

Entry Requirements
There are no formal entry requirements for this course.
Placement
Completing Vocational Placement is compulsory with the early childhood electives focus, you are required to undertake a minimum of 50 hours of Vocational Placement to complete this course.
Assessment Methods
Skill and knowledge assessments are an essential step in progressing through your course. You may be assessed in a number of ways while you are studying at TAFE Queensland, including observation, written assessment, questioning, portfolios, work samples, third-party feedback, and through recognition of prior learning.
